Benue Gov Explains Meeting With Tinubu Alongside Suswam

Benue State Governor, Hyacinth Alia, has expressed confidence that the All Progressives Congress (APC) in the state will resolve the disagreements that emerged following its recent primary elections.

According to reports, Alia made the remarks on Monday while speaking with State House correspondents after a private meeting with President Bola Tinubu at the Presidential Villa in Abuja.

The meeting came amid tension within the Benue APC following the replacement of some of the governor’s allies on the final list of National Assembly candidates submitted to the Independent National Electoral Commission (INEC) ahead of the 2027 general elections.

Addressing the concerns among party members, the governor said he remained optimistic that those affected by the developments would embrace dialogue and continue to work toward strengthening the party.

Alia noted that President Tinubu’s experience as a democrat and grassroots politician would help the party overcome its internal challenges.

“I know that there are some agitations from APC faithful after the primaries, but I believe that it’s going to calm down. Mr President is a democrat who understands this,” the governor said.

He further stated that the APC remained united in its commitment to advancing its political fortunes in Benue State, expressing confidence that the party would record improved performance in the 2027 elections.

The governor also pledged to increase President Tinubu’s support base in the state, saying the APC would work toward delivering stronger electoral results.

Alia explained that his discussion with the President covered key issues, including political developments, security challenges and humanitarian concerns affecting Benue State.

He said the visit was also an opportunity to appreciate Tinubu for attending the Benue at 50 anniversary celebration and for commissioning projects during his visit to the state.

The governor added that he provided the President with an update on the security situation in Benue, noting that there had been improvements, although challenges remained, particularly regarding the safe return of internally displaced persons to their communities as the farming season progresses.

Former Benue State Governor, Gabriel Suswam, accompanied Governor Alia during the visit to President Tinubu at the Presidential Villa.
